Skip to content
ptittof57 edited this page Aug 15, 2015 · 5 revisions
<title>SA1639: FileHeaderMustHaveSummary</title> <script src="script/helpstudio.js" type="text/javascript"></script> <script src="script/StandardText.js" type="text/jscript"></script>
<script type="text/jscript">WritePageTop(document.title);</script>

TypeName

FileHeaderMustHaveSummary

CheckId

SA1639

Category

Documentation Rules

Cause

The file header at the top of a C# code file does not contain a filled-in summary tag.

Rule Description

A violation of this rule occurs when the file header at the top of a C# file does not contain a valid summary tag. This rule is disabled by default.

For example:

//-----------------------------------------------------------------------

// <copyright file="Widget.cs" company="My Company">

// Custom company copyright tag.

// </copyright>

//-----------------------------------------------------------------------

If this rule is enabled, the file header should contain a summary tag. For example:

//-----------------------------------------------------------------------

// <copyright file="Widget.cs" company="My Company">

// Custom company copyright tag.

// </copyright>

// <summary>This is the Widget class.</summary>

//-----------------------------------------------------------------------

How to Fix Violations

To fix a violation of this rule, add and fill-in a summary tag describing the contents of the file.

How to Suppress Violations

[SuppressMessage("StyleCop.CSharp.DocumentationRules", "SA1639:FileHeaderMustHaveSummary", Justification = "Reviewed.")]
Clone this wiki locally